Tiredness and shortness of breath are concerning symptoms in a pediatric patient as they can indicate underlying health issues, such as respiratory or cardiovascular conditions. These symptoms may suggest that the child's body is not getting adequate oxygen or that there is a problem with how the heart or lungs function, which can be serious.

In contrast, increased appetite and weight gain do not typically signify immediate health concerns but may warrant further investigation if they are excessive or uncharacteristic. Frequent coughing could indicate a respiratory infection or allergies but is less alarming than the combination of tiredness and shortness of breath, which can point to more critical conditions demanding prompt medical attention.
